Transaction 8ab25592942a6496942bec0002e23eb89933d43fd7006f5e96b8e7ba8562de38
1 Input
1 Output
-
8ab25592942a6496942bec0002e23eb89933d43fd7006f5e96b8e7ba8562de38:0
- value
- 499853
- script pubkey
- OP_0 OP_PUSHBYTES_20 44482107c678b988aa50fcfba9a9b0c8bb46f416
- address
- tb1qg3yzzp7x0zuc32jslna6n2dseza5daqkcyjszn